I'M Not Ready
I can hear you get ready to take your last breath; I'm not ready for you to leave just yet. As you dream a long peaceful dream of finally visiting the Celestial Kingdom, though you have dreamed of this place constantly, I'm not ready for you to watch over us yet. I'm not ready to see you lie six feet underground. I'm not ready to no longer see the twinkle in your eye. I'm not ready to hear your prelude end, for your sun to set, and your moon to glow. I'm not ready, so let me prepare, let me see the twinkle in your eye, let me hear your prelude loud and proud, let me see your radiant sun shine bright, then maybe I'll be ready. maybe I'll be ready to stop seeing the twinkle in your eye, to hear your prelude end in a soft sad chord, to let your sun set and your moon to glow, to let you sprout wings and fly to the Celestial Kingdom, to watch over me for always and eternity.
